Skoda Vison O: A Fresh Take on Skoda's Estate Heritage

For years, Skoda's estate models like the Octavia Combi and Superb Combi have been favorites among European customers, known for their spaciousness, reliability and clever features. The Vision O concept carries this legacy forward, yet with a strong shift toward modernity. Built from the ground up with the customer in mind, the concept reflects a minimalist, functional design philosophy that doesn't just look good but also improves usability.
Gone are unnecessary buttons and cluttered interfaces. Instead, the Vision O offers an intuitive and clean interior which is simple but looks sophisticated. The focus is on space, comfort and practicality - key reasons why estate vehicles remain popular. Notably, the concept delivers over 650 litres of luggage space and promises the same versatility that customers have come to expect, but with a futuristic edge.
Skoda Vision O: Smart and Connected

What makes the Vision O truly special is how it integrates advanced technologies aimed at making every trip smarter and more enjoyable. The cabin introduces a fully digital interface with customizable displays that adapt to each passenger's preferences. A personal AI assistant, named Laura, guides users by offering relevant information during their journey, creating a seamless interaction between driver, passengers, and the car.
The interior also adapts to its environment. Bio-Adaptive Lighting adjusts automatically to natural light cycles, reducing eye strain and enhancing comfort. For those small but essential conveniences, Skoda hasn't forgotten its signature "Simply Clever" features - including a portable speaker system and even an integrated fridge, emphasizing that thoughtful details still matter.
Driving Toward Sustainability

As the name suggests - the Vision O focuses on responsible material sourcing, waste-free production and end-of-life recycling. Skoda demonstrates that eco-friendly materials, including plant-based products, can be high-quality, durable and attractive.
Beyond just green materials, the Vision O reflects a broader commitment to environmental responsibility, where every component from the manufacturing process to the choice of materials is selected to reduce the ecological footprint and this is something that offer customers a guilt-free driving experience.
Aerodynamic and Ready for Autonomy

Visually, the Vision O has clean lines and a distinctive new front Tech-loop mask contribute not just to a modern aesthetic but also improved aerodynamics which ensure better range for longer trips on a single charge.
Moreover, Skoda is integrating advanced autonomous driving technologies into the Vision O. In certain conditions, the car takes full control, handling all driving tasks, giving drivers a glimpse of the autonomous future that's on the horizon without compromising safety.
